Barrie Food Bank Holiday Drive Underway

Hoping for 180,000 pounds of food under the tree

For many, Christmas is a joyous season, but not for everyone. The Barrie Food Bank has launched its annual Holiday Food Drive in hopes of raising 180,000 pounds of food to refill the shelves and help families in need into the new year. The food bank distributes 75 thousand pounds of food a month to 2600 people (600 households). The most needed items at the food bank include: powdered milk, peanut butter, canned stew, canned luncheon meats, juices, rice, baby food and formula, canned tuna, mayonnaise, canned vegetables, soups, can pasta, macaroni, school snacks, sugar, flour, pancake mix, condiments such as ketchup and mustard and personal hygiene products soap, shampoo, toothpaste and feminine products. Financial donations are also welcome. Those donations help to purchase perishable items such as eggs, cheese, margarine, fresh produce and meats that can be included with each grocery order.
